    LEWIS GRIFFITH BRILEY

Lewis Griffith Briley, 87, of Pipe Creek, passed away on Thursday, December 23, 2021, at his home in Pipe Creek. He was born in White Springs, Florida to Albert W. Castleberry and Anne Holley on August 29, 1934. He was adopted by Homer G. Briley in 1936. He married Mary E. Clark, of Bandera, on November 3, 1960.

He went to school in Winter Garden, Florida and joined The United States Air Force on May 16, 1957. He retired after serving over 20 years.

Lewis is preceded in death by his mother, adopted father and sisters, Eleanor and Shirley.

Lewis is survived by his wife, Mary Briley, his daughter Natalie Moore, her husband, Shane Moore and his son, Don Briley. He was known as PopPop to eight grandchildren: Jennifer Weatherington, her husband, Greg, Shawn Moore, his wife Amie, Ashley Briley, Brownyn Watts, her husband Zach, Shelby Odom, her husband Josh, Chris Reyna, Shannon Moore and Erin Briley. He and Mary were blessed with thirteen great-grandchildren: Logan, Sophia, Aubrie, Lane, Drayden, Brielynn, Levyn, Zoey, Daniel, Josh Jr, Mallory, Nicole and Kyron.

Visitation was at 1 p.m. Wednesday December 29 at Grimes Funeral Home in Bandera, Texas.

Funeral Services was held at 2 p.m. on Wednesday, December 29th at Grimes Funeral Home in Bandera, Texas with Chaplin Larry Smith. Burial followed at Pipe Creek Cemetery.
